Nettet19. jul. 2024 · Logs being created by Systemd are managed in the so called Journal. These logs can be accessed via the journalctl binary. If journalctl is called without any parameter, it will print out the whole Journal. However, it is also possible to output the log entries of specific units only.

NettetStep 8 — Cleaning up old journal entries. The journalctl command also provides control over how much space is used up by the journal, and when to clean up older entries. You can use the --disk-usage flag to discover how much is currently being used up: journalctl --disk-usage.
